During 2011 to 2013 we developed The Marine Biodiversity Atlas of Southwestern Portugal covering an extension of shoreline of 200 km between Tróia and Burgau (SW Portugal).
Surveys included visual observations and underwater sampling points. The main output of this project was to identify and characterise natural habitats, marine ecosystems and their biodiversity.
The data collected will be used to develop a website to create public environmental awareness and education, to capture the interest of the general public to some of the most fascinating natural dynamic and sensitive ecosystems.
